Guidelines for validating and normalizing time zones and timestamp conventions to preserve temporal integrity in analytics.
This evergreen guide outlines practical steps for validating time zone data, normalizing timestamps, and preserving temporal integrity across distributed analytics pipelines and reporting systems.
Published July 16, 2025
Facebook X Reddit Pinterest Email
In data analytics, time is more than a sequencing marker; it is a dimension that anchors events, trends, and comparisons across regions and systems. When timestamps originate in different time zones or adopt inconsistent formats, downstream analyses risk misalignment, incorrect aggregations, and misleading conclusions. A robust approach begins with explicit policy definitions that cover clock granularity, time zone labeling, and daylight saving transitions. By codifying these choices, organizations can prevent ad hoc conversions that drift over time and ensure reproducibility for analysts and automated models. The initial step is to inventory all sources of temporal data, map each to a canonical representation, and document any exceptions that require special handling or contextual interpretation.
Once sources are mapped, you should establish a single, authoritative time standard that your processing engines will honor consistently. This often means storing and operating on Coordinated Universal Time (UTC) internally, while preserving the ability to present localized views to end users. The transition requires tooling that can translate UTC back to target time zones without losing precision, particularly for timestamps with sub-second granularity. Establishing this discipline reduces drift during ETL pipelines, ensures that event windows align across services, and simplifies cross-domain analytics such as cohort construction, anomaly detection, and forecasting. In practice, you will implement consistent parsing, normalization, and formatting rules across all data ingress points.
Build robust validation and normalization into every data flow.
The first core practice is deterministic parsing, where each timestamp is interpreted according to clearly defined rules rather than relying on system defaults. This means specifying the source format, the presence of time zone offsets, and whether ambiguous values should be rejected or inferred with sensible fallbacks. Enforcing strict parsing reduces the likelihood of silent conversions that can accumulate into large errors when historical data is compared with fresh ingest. It also makes error handling predictable, enabling automated workflows to flag and quarantine suspicious records. In a defensible data architecture, every timestamp carries provenance metadata indicating its origin, the rules used for interpretation, and any adjustments applied during normalization.
ADVERTISEMENT
ADVERTISEMENT
Normalization transforms every timestamp into a canonical representation that supports reliable comparison and aggregation. UTC-based storage is a common choice because it provides a uniform baseline across global data streams. However, normalization also demands careful handling of historical time zone rules, as offsets and daylight saving practices shift over decades. Your pipeline should include modules that apply time zone databases with versioned histories, ensuring that past events reflect the correct local context at their time of occurrence. Validation during normalization should verify that the resulting value preserves the intended temporal order and that no duplicate or conflicting records emerge from the process.
Create clear, reproducible formatting and display standards.
Validation rules must cover both syntactic and semantic dimensions of timestamps. Syntactic checks confirm that values adhere to the accepted patterns and do not contain impossible dates, such as February 30th. Semantic checks verify logical consistency, such as ensuring a timestamp does not precede the origin of the dataset or contradict known event sequences. For distributed systems, you should test edge cases like leap years, leap seconds, and clock skew between services. By embedding these checks into your data contracts, you create early alerts for data quality issues and reduce the cost of late remediation. Documentation of rules and failure modes is essential for maintenance and onboarding new teams.
ADVERTISEMENT
ADVERTISEMENT
In addition to validation, you should enforce strict formatting conventions for downstream consumption and reporting. This includes consistent display of time zone indicators, stable string formats, and unambiguous naming in schemas. When end-user interfaces present time data, offer clear options to view timestamps in local time or in UTC, accompanied by explicit references to the applied offset. Reproducibility hinges on preserving the exact timestamp value while enabling practical interpretation for different audiences. A well-documented format policy helps analytics engineers reproduce results, compare findings across dashboards, and support auditability during regulatory reviews.
Establish ongoing testing and monitoring for temporal integrity.
A practical approach to handling daylight saving transitions is to store clocks and events with unambiguous shift information rather than relying solely on naive offsets. In regions that observe DST, the same local time can occur in different UTC offsets depending on the date. Your system should record the actual UTC instant, plus optional fields that describe the local time interpretation when it matters for business logic. This distinction prevents subtle errors in scheduling, alerting, and window-based calculations. It also helps analysts understand the real-world context behind each timestamp, which is critical for accurate trend analysis and historical comparisons.
Complement these practices with rigorous testing and data quality monitoring. Create test datasets that include scenarios such as historical zone changes, cross-border events, and ambiguous entries flagged for human review. Automated tests should verify that normalization preserves temporal order, that conversions are reversible when appropriate, and that no information is lost during round-trips between storage and presentation layers. Ongoing monitoring dashboards can highlight anomalies, such as sudden surges in events with inconsistent offsets or unexpected gaps in time series. Establish service-level objectives for timestamp integrity and integrate them into the overall data governance model.
ADVERTISEMENT
ADVERTISEMENT
Document, audit, and share temporal conventions openly.
Governance plays a central role in sustaining time-related standards. Roles and responsibilities should be clearly defined for data stewards, engineers, and analysts, with documented rituals for policy updates, retirements, and exception handling. Versioning of time zone databases and timestamp formats is essential so that historical analyses can be revisited with full provenance. Change management processes must consider backward compatibility, ensuring that changes do not abruptly alter historical interpretations. By embedding temporal governance into broader data governance, organizations can maintain trust across teams and support consistent analytics outcomes as the data landscape evolves.
Finally, design for interoperability so external partners and downstream consumers can align with your conventions. When sharing datasets, supply metadata that describes the encoding, time zone conventions, and normalization decisions used. Provide schemas and documentation that enable partners to reproduce your results without guessing. If you publish APIs or data streams, offer explicit parameters for regional views, preferred time zone targets, and the UTC baseline employed inside the system. Interoperability reduces friction in collaborations and minimizes misinterpretations that could otherwise undermine the value of shared analytics.
In practice, the guidelines outlined here translate into concrete engineering patterns. Use a central time service or library that understands time zones, offsets, and historical transitions, and ensure every service consumes this canonical source. Implement end-to-end data lineage that traces timestamps from the point of capture through to final reports, including any transformations that occur along the way. Regularly audit data samples against known benchmarks to detect drift, and enforce automated remediation when justified. By combining deterministic parsing, canonical normalization, and transparent governance, you create a durable foundation for temporal analytics that remains reliable as systems scale and evolve.
The evergreen take-away is that temporal integrity requires discipline, not ad hoc fixes. When teams agree on explicit standards for parsing, normalization, formatting, and presentation, time becomes a trustworthy dimension rather than a source of confusion. Invest in culture and tooling that promote reproducibility, auditability, and clear accountability for timestamp health. With robust validation, precise normalization, and proactive monitoring, analytics initiatives can confidently compare events across time zones, deliver accurate insights, and sustain value in an increasingly global data landscape.
Related Articles
Data quality
A practical guide to harmonizing semantic meaning across diverse domains, outlining thoughtful alignment strategies, governance practices, and machine-assisted verification to preserve data integrity during integration.
-
July 28, 2025
Data quality
Differential privacy blends mathematical guarantees with practical data analytics, advocating carefully tuned noise, rigorous risk assessment, and ongoing utility checks to protect individuals without rendering insights obsolete.
-
August 04, 2025
Data quality
A practical, field-tested guide to rapid detection, containment, recovery, and resilient restoration that minimizes downtime, protects stakeholder trust, and preserves data integrity across complex, evolving environments.
-
July 30, 2025
Data quality
Building data quality systems that honor user consent requires clear governance, transparent processes, and adaptable technical controls that align privacy laws with practical analytics needs.
-
July 18, 2025
Data quality
Building resilient feature validation requires systematic checks, versioning, and continuous monitoring to safeguard models against stale, malformed, or corrupted inputs infiltrating production pipelines.
-
July 30, 2025
Data quality
In modern data ecosystems, scalable deduplication must balance speed, accuracy, and fidelity, leveraging parallel architectures, probabilistic methods, and domain-aware normalization to minimize false matches while preserving critical historical records for analytics and governance.
-
July 30, 2025
Data quality
This evergreen guide explains how to design robust sample based audits that yield reliable, scalable insights into dataset quality, addressing sampling theory, implementation challenges, and practical governance considerations for large data ecosystems.
-
August 09, 2025
Data quality
This evergreen guide explains how organizations quantify the business value of automated data quality tooling, linking data improvements to decision accuracy, speed, risk reduction, and long-term analytic performance across diverse analytics programs.
-
July 16, 2025
Data quality
Crafting a disciplined approach to data quality remediation that centers on customer outcomes, product reliability, and sustainable retention requires cross-functional alignment, measurable goals, and disciplined prioritization across data domains and product features.
-
August 08, 2025
Data quality
An evergreen guide to building robust drift detection that distinguishes authentic seasonal changes from degrading data, enabling teams to act decisively, preserve model accuracy, and sustain reliable decision-making over time.
-
July 21, 2025
Data quality
Active learning strategies empower teams to refine labeled data quality by targeted querying, continuous feedback, and scalable human-in-the-loop processes that align labeling with model needs and evolving project goals.
-
July 15, 2025
Data quality
Achieving consistent measurement units across data sources is essential for reliable analytics, preventing misinterpretations, reducing costly errors, and enabling seamless data integration through a disciplined standardization approach.
-
August 04, 2025
Data quality
This article guides teams through durable strategies for validating behavioral and event tracking implementations, ensuring data integrity, reliable metrics, and actionable insights across platforms and user journeys.
-
August 12, 2025
Data quality
This evergreen guide explores practical methods to craft sampling heuristics that target rare, high‑impact, or suspicious data segments, reducing review load while preserving analytical integrity and detection power.
-
July 16, 2025
Data quality
This evergreen guide explains how to blend statistical profiling with explicit rule checks, revealing robust workflows, practical strategies, and governance practices that collectively elevate dataset reliability across diverse data ecosystems.
-
July 30, 2025
Data quality
This evergreen guide explains how lightweight labeling audits can safeguard annotation quality, integrate seamlessly into ongoing pipelines, and sustain high data integrity without slowing teams or disrupting production rhythms.
-
July 18, 2025
Data quality
Frontline user feedback mechanisms empower teams to identify data quality issues early, with structured flagging, contextual annotations, and robust governance to sustain reliable analytics and informed decision making.
-
July 18, 2025
Data quality
Establish robust, scalable procedures for acquiring external data by outlining quality checks, traceable provenance, and strict legal constraints, ensuring ethical sourcing and reliable analytics across teams.
-
July 15, 2025
Data quality
Achieving superior product data quality transforms how customers discover items, receive relevant recommendations, and decide to buy, with measurable gains in search precision, personalized suggestions, and higher conversion rates across channels.
-
July 24, 2025
Data quality
This evergreen guide explores practical strategies for crafting SDKs and client libraries that empower data producers to preempt errors, enforce quality gates, and ensure accurate, reliable data reaches analytics pipelines.
-
August 12, 2025